The Best Connection (Newcastle) is currently recruiting an experienced HGV Class 2 Tipper Driver to join our well-established client based in the Blaydon area. This is a fantastic opportunity for a HGV Class 2 Tipper Driver looking for consistent, local work with a reputable civil engineering specialist.

The Role

  • Operating an 8‑wheel Class 2 tipper vehicle.
  • Transporting aggregates, soil, and muck‑away materials.
  • Navigating active construction sites and quarries safely.
  • Conducting daily vehicle walk‑around checks.
  • Adhering to all tachograph and driving regulations.

Pay & Hours

  • £15.00 per hour.
  • Monday to Friday operations.
  • Typical start times: 06:30 / 07:00.
  • Ongoing long‑term work available for the right driver.

Requirements

  • Valid HGV Class 2 (Category C) Licence.
  • Up‑to‑date CPC and digital tachograph card.
  • Previous experience operating a tipper or 8‑wheel rigid vehicle (preferred).
  • Good knowledge of the North East road network.
  • Ability to work independently and follow site safety protocols.
